T75.22 — Traumatic vasospastic syndrome
T75.22 is a non-billable header ICD-10-CM code for traumatic vasospastic syndrome. It cannot be billed on its own: choose one of the more specific child codes below. This code also requires a 7th character before it is complete.
This code requires a 7th character
The appropriate 7th character is to be added to each code from category T75
- A
- initial encounter
- D
- subsequent encounter
- S
- sequela

How T75.22 is indexed
Coders do not find codes by browsing the tabular list — they look them up in the alphabetic index, under the word the physician wrote. These are the index entries that lead here, so you can see which chart wordings map to T75.22.
- Syndrome›traumatic vasospastic
- Syndrome›vasospastic(traumatic)
- Vibration›adverse effects›vasospastic syndrome

Questions about T75.22
- Is T75.22 a billable ICD-10-CM code?
- No. T75.22 is a non-billable header code. Code to a higher level of specificity using one of its child codes.
- Where does T75.22 sit in the tabular list?
- Injury, poisoning and certain other consequences of external causes (S00-T88), in the block Other and unspecified effects of external causes (T66-T78).
